The fastest way to kill an enterprise AI program is to pitch it as the new system of record. Replace the WCS. Replace the MES. Replace core banking. Replace the newsroom desk. Executives hear transformation. Operators hear years of cutover risk. Security hears a new blast radius. The pilot never reaches Assist.
Integrate, don't replace is the doctrine we lead with across industrial, fintech, and media work: AI sits above the systems that already own truth, extends them with diagnosis and drafts, and writes only through gated connectors humans can defend.
It is not a softer ambition. It is how governed AI survives contact with plants, hubs, and newsrooms.
What "System of Record" Means in Practice
A system of record is wherever the organization already settles arguments.
- Parcel divert truth lives in WCS/MFC—not in a chatbot.
- Cell equipment state lives in OPC-UA/historian and MES—not in a 3D viewer.
- Detention clocks and tariffs live in commercial rules and event logs—not in a model summary.
- Rundowns and air authority live in the desk—not in a draft engine.
- Balances and postings live in core ledgers—not in an agent toolbelt.
AI can read those systems, explain them, and propose changes. When AI becomes them, you inherit every political and regulatory obligation overnight. Most teams cannot staff that.

The Failure Pattern We Keep Autopsying
A vendor demo shows an agent creating work orders, posting billing corrections, and "updating the twin" in one happy path. The demo database is empty of union rules, change boards, OEM contracts, and audit requirements. Procurement is impressed. OT and desk leads are not in the room.
Ninety days later:
- Read integrations are partial
- Write integrations are blocked
- Operators bypass the tool
- Leadership concludes "AI doesn't work here"
AI worked fine. The SoR strategy did not.

A Reference Architecture Buyers Can Demand
When we write architecture briefs, the diagram always has four bands:
- Systems of record — unchanged ownership
- Read connectors — signals, events, documents
- Reasoning / draft layer — agents, retrieval, format engines
- Approval + write adapters — RBAC, audit, narrow execute APIs
The LLM lives in band 3. Irreversible commits live in band 4 with humans. If a vendor diagram collapses 3 and 4 into "the agent," you are looking at demo architecture.

Political Reality Is Part of the Architecture
OEM relationships, union work rules, editorial standards, bank change boards—these are not "change management afterward." They are constraints on day one.
Integrate-don't-replace gives each stakeholder a sentence they can defend:
- OEM / plant IT: we extend your control stack; we do not fork it
- Revenue assurance: corrections are proposed with evidence, not silent posts
- Editors: drafts accelerate; air authority stays with the desk
- Risk / compliance: execute tools are narrow, audited, and sealable
- Operators: Shadow first; Assist only when rejection rates look sane
Programs that cannot offer those sentences will be quietly starved of data access.
When Replacement Is Appropriate
Rarely—and narrowly. Greenfield cells with no MES yet. A disposable internal tool with no audit surface. A sandbox brand with no legacy desk.
Even then, design as if a SoR will appear: stable IDs, event logs, approval hooks. The cost of adding discipline early is lower than the cost of extracting an agent that became an accidental ledger.

Checklist for RFP Language
Paste into your next RFP:
- Vendor must name each SoR extended and each SoR not replaced
- Write paths require human approval classes for money, safety, and publish
- Shadow Mode with logged recommendations before Assist
- Append-only audit of proposals and approvals
- Connector swap / read-path plan before production writes
- Synthetic demo metrics labeled as synthetic
- Explicit non-goals list
